These emotional Dancing with the Stars dances lifted our spirits. For this list, well be looking at the routines that moved us with their beautiful movements and heartrending narratives on the dance competition television series. Our countdown includes Jodie Sweetin & Keo Motsepes Foxtrot, Noah Galloway & Sharna Burgess freestyle, Selma Blair & Sasha Farbers Viennese Waltz, and more! Which DWTS dance got YOU emotional?
